Paolo Bonzini wrote:
> > Here's a patch to make that diagnostic go where it belongs
> > for all gnulib-using projects:
> 
> I wonder if we shouldn't do that for all _autoconf_-using projects!

Or, at least, for all tests in all gnulib-using projects. There are
more possible causes of a FORTIFY message, according to
  <https://wiki.edubuntu.org/CompilerFlags>

How about this proposed patch?

+  dnl Preparation for running test programs:
+  dnl Tell glibc to write diagnostics from -D_FORTIFY_SOURCE=2 to stderr, not
+  dnl to /dev/tty, so that can be redirected to log files. Such diagnostics
+  dnl occur e.g. in the macros gl_PRINTF_DIRECTIVE_N, gl_SNPRINTF_DIRECTIVE_N.
+  LIBC_FATAL_STDERR_=1
+  export LIBC_FATAL_STDERR_
